Materials

Soffits and fascia boards are a vital part of any home's roof. They keep moisture and pests from causing damage to the roof. They also stop water from accumulating around the house and causing damage to foundations, windows, doors and other areas of the house. The soffit and fascia also allow for ventilation in the attic space. If the structures are damaged, it's important to contact a professional to repair them. They can be constructed from various materials including wood and aluminum. The cost and durability of your fascia boards as well as soffit will depend on the type of material you choose.

When it's time to replace your fascia and soffits it's crucial to select the appropriate materials. Different materials have their own advantages and disadvantages, so it's a good idea to consult with an expert local roofing company for guidance. Wood products, for example, are a popular choice because of their aesthetic appeal and durability. They are also susceptible to rot and insect infestation. Vinyl and fiber cement are also options. These are more resistant to rot and weather damage than wood, however they are more expensive.

Maintenance

The maintenance and repair of soffit as well as fascia is essential to the health of your home. They help protect your roof from water damage and deterioration by directing rainwater away the wall and into the gutters. They also help to ventilate the attic, which helps keep your home cool in summer and warm in winter.

Soffits and fascia are typically made of aluminum or wood. They are designed to keep moisture, pests and debris out of the home. They also serve as the base for gutter installations. After a long period of exposure, they could need to be replaced or repaired.

If your soffit and fascia are in poor condition, it is crucial to fix them as soon as you can. This will help prevent mold, rot, and other issues that can cost a lot to fix. Watch for signs of damage such as cracks, warping and sagging. If you see any of these signs, it's time to call in an expert to repair your fascia and soffit.
